Strategic Material Selection Guide for music equipment names

When selecting materials for music equipment names, it’s essential to consider various properties that influence performance, durability, and overall suitability for specific applications. Below, we analyze four common materials used in the music equipment industry, focusing on their key properties, advantages and disadvantages, impacts on applications, and considerations for international B2B buyers.

1. Wood

Key Properties: Wood is prized for its acoustic properties, making it an ideal choice for instruments like guitars and pianos. It has a natural ability to resonate sound, which can enhance tonal quality. However, wood is sensitive to humidity and temperature changes, affecting its stability.

Pros & Cons:
Advantages: Excellent sound quality, aesthetic appeal, and ease of shaping and finishing.
Disadvantages: Vulnerable to warping, cracking, and pest damage. It can also be relatively expensive depending on the type of wood.

Impact on Application: Wood is commonly used in acoustic instruments where sound quality is paramount. The choice of wood can significantly influence the tonal characteristics, making it critical for manufacturers to select the right type.

Considerations for International Buyers: Buyers should be aware of local regulations regarding wood sourcing, especially concerning endangered species. Compliance with standards like CITES (Convention on International Trade in Endangered Species) is crucial, particularly in regions like Europe and the Middle East.

2. Metal (Aluminum)

Key Properties: Aluminum is lightweight yet strong, with excellent corrosion resistance. It can withstand a range of temperatures, making it suitable for various environments.

Pros & Cons:
Advantages: Durable, lightweight, and resistant to rust and corrosion, which extends the product’s lifespan.
Disadvantages: Higher manufacturing complexity and cost compared to some plastics. It may not provide the best acoustic properties for certain instruments.

Impact on Application: Aluminum is often used in hardware components (like stands and mounts) and electronic enclosures, where weight and durability are critical. It is also used in some electronic instruments due to its shielding properties.

Considerations for International Buyers: Buyers should consider the availability of aluminum grades that meet specific standards such as ASTM or DIN. Additionally, understanding local recycling regulations can be beneficial, as aluminum is highly recyclable.

3. Plastic (Polycarbonate)

Key Properties: Polycarbonate is known for its high impact resistance and clarity. It can withstand high temperatures and is often used in applications requiring transparency.

Pros & Cons:
Advantages: Lightweight, shatter-resistant, and cost-effective. It can be molded into complex shapes, allowing for innovative designs.
Disadvantages: Less durable than metals in terms of structural integrity and may degrade under UV exposure.

Impact on Application: Commonly used in electronic components, protective covers, and some instrument bodies, polycarbonate is ideal for portable equipment that requires durability without added weight.

Considerations for International Buyers: Buyers should ensure that the polycarbonate used meets safety standards, especially in regions with strict regulations. Additionally, understanding the environmental impact and recycling options for plastics is increasingly important.

4. Composite Materials

Key Properties: Composites combine materials to achieve superior strength-to-weight ratios and resistance to environmental factors. They can be engineered for specific applications, offering versatility.

Pros & Cons:
Advantages: High durability, resistance to moisture and temperature fluctuations, and customizable properties.
Disadvantages: Generally more expensive to produce and may require specialized manufacturing processes.

Impact on Application: Composites are often used in high-end instruments and professional audio equipment, where performance and longevity are critical. They can also be tailored for specific sound qualities.

Considerations for International Buyers: Buyers should verify that composite materials comply with relevant safety and environmental regulations. Understanding the manufacturing standards in their region can also help in ensuring product quality.

In-depth Look: Manufacturing Processes and Quality Assurance for music equipment names

The manufacturing of music equipment involves several critical stages, each of which contributes to the final product’s quality, reliability, and performance. For international B2B buyers, particularly those from regions like Africa, South America, the Middle East, and Europe, understanding these processes is essential for making informed purchasing decisions.

Manufacturing Processes

Material Preparation

The first stage in manufacturing music equipment is material preparation, which involves sourcing high-quality raw materials. For instance, wood for acoustic instruments is carefully selected based on species, grain, and moisture content. Metals used in electronic components must meet specific standards for conductivity and durability. Suppliers often provide certifications for materials, ensuring they meet international standards.

Forming

Once materials are prepared, they undergo forming, which can take various shapes depending on the product. Techniques such as molding, cutting, and machining are commonly employed. For example, guitar bodies may be carved from solid wood blocks using CNC machines for precision, while metal parts might be stamped or laser-cut. This stage is crucial as it sets the foundation for the instrument’s sound and functionality.

Assembly

The assembly stage brings together all the formed components. Skilled labor is often involved, especially in high-end products where craftsmanship is paramount. Automated assembly lines may also be used for mass production, particularly in electronic devices. During assembly, components like pickups, circuits, and hardware are integrated into the instrument, ensuring each part functions harmoniously.

Finishing

The final stage is finishing, which includes painting, polishing, and applying protective coatings. This not only enhances the aesthetic appeal but also protects the equipment from environmental factors. For electronic devices, this stage may involve installing software or firmware updates to ensure optimal performance. Quality checks are performed at each stage to catch any defects early in the process.

Quality Assurance

Quality assurance (QA) is paramount in the music equipment manufacturing process, ensuring that products meet both industry standards and customer expectations. B2B buyers should be familiar with the key aspects of QA relevant to their purchasing decisions.

International Standards

Many manufacturers adhere to international quality standards such as ISO 9001, which outlines criteria for a quality management system. Compliance with ISO standards assures buyers that the manufacturer has established processes for consistent quality. Additionally, industry-specific certifications, such as CE marking in Europe and API standards for audio equipment, indicate compliance with safety and performance regulations.

Quality Control Checkpoints

Quality control (QC) involves several checkpoints throughout the manufacturing process:

  • Incoming Quality Control (IQC): This involves inspecting raw materials upon arrival to ensure they meet specifications.
  • In-Process Quality Control (IPQC): During production, random samples are tested to monitor quality and detect defects early.
  • Final Quality Control (FQC): Once the product is completed, it undergoes a thorough inspection and testing phase before shipping.

These checkpoints help to maintain high-quality standards throughout production.

Common Testing Methods

Several testing methods are employed to ensure the performance and reliability of music equipment:

  • Acoustic Testing: For instruments, sound quality is tested in controlled environments to assess tonal characteristics.
  • Durability Testing: Equipment is subjected to stress tests to evaluate its resilience against wear and tear.
  • Electrical Testing: For electronic devices, tests are conducted to measure voltage, resistance, and overall functionality.

Comprehensive Cost and Pricing Analysis for music equipment names Sourcing

Understanding the cost structure and pricing dynamics of sourcing music equipment is crucial for international B2B buyers. This analysis will provide insights into the cost components, price influencers, and practical tips for effective purchasing strategies.

Cost Components

  1. Materials: The raw materials used in music equipment manufacturing, such as wood for instruments, metals for electronics, and plastics for enclosures, significantly influence costs. Higher quality materials often lead to increased prices, so it’s essential to assess the balance between quality and budget.

  2. Labor: Labor costs vary widely depending on the region. For instance, labor in Europe may be more expensive than in parts of Africa or South America. Understanding local labor rates can help buyers negotiate better terms.

  3. Manufacturing Overhead: This includes costs related to production facilities, equipment maintenance, and utilities. Manufacturers with advanced automation may have lower overhead costs, which can be a negotiating point for buyers.

  4. Tooling: Custom tooling for specific equipment can add to initial costs. Buyers should inquire about tooling costs for customized products, as these can significantly affect the total price.

  5. Quality Control (QC): Ensuring product quality involves additional costs. Companies that emphasize rigorous QC processes may charge more, but this can lead to long-term savings through reduced defect rates.

  6. Logistics: Transportation and shipping costs, influenced by the distance from the manufacturer to the buyer, play a crucial role. Buyers should consider various shipping options and associated costs, including tariffs and import duties, especially for international transactions.

  7. Margin: The manufacturer’s desired profit margin will also influence pricing. Understanding typical margins in the industry can help buyers gauge whether a quote is reasonable.

Price Influencers

  • Volume and Minimum Order Quantity (MOQ): Larger orders often come with discounts. Buyers should assess their needs carefully to negotiate favorable terms based on anticipated volumes.

  • Specifications and Customization: Custom specifications can lead to higher costs due to additional tooling and labor. It’s advisable to standardize orders where possible to leverage cost efficiencies.

  • Materials and Quality Certifications: Equipment certified for quality and safety standards (e.g., ISO certifications) may command higher prices. Buyers must weigh the benefits of such certifications against their budgets.

  • Supplier Factors: The reputation and reliability of suppliers can affect pricing. Established manufacturers may charge more but can provide assurance of quality and service reliability.

  • Incoterms: Understanding Incoterms (International Commercial Terms) is crucial as they define the responsibilities of buyers and sellers in shipping. These terms can significantly impact the total landed cost.

Essential Technical Properties and Trade Terminology for music equipment names

Key Technical Properties of Music Equipment

Understanding the essential technical properties of music equipment is crucial for B2B buyers to ensure they select the right products that meet their operational needs. Below are some critical specifications to consider:

  1. Material Grade
    Definition: The quality and type of material used in manufacturing music equipment, such as wood for instruments or metal for hardware.
    Importance: Higher-grade materials often result in better sound quality and durability, which can significantly impact the performance of the equipment. For instance, solid wood instruments typically produce superior acoustics compared to laminate materials.

  2. Tolerance
    Definition: The permissible limit of variation in a physical dimension or measurement.
    Importance: In the music equipment industry, maintaining precise tolerances is essential for ensuring parts fit together correctly, which affects the overall sound quality and performance. For example, the tolerances in the construction of a guitar neck can influence playability and intonation.

  3. Power Handling
    Definition: The maximum amount of power that an amplifier or speaker can handle without distortion or damage.
    Importance: This specification is vital for ensuring that the equipment can perform at required levels without risking damage. B2B buyers must match power handling capabilities with the intended use, such as live performances versus studio recordings.

  4. Frequency Response
    Definition: The range of frequencies that a piece of audio equipment can reproduce effectively.
    Importance: A wider frequency response typically allows for a more accurate representation of sound, which is critical for both recording and live sound applications. Buyers should consider this specification to ensure the equipment meets the audio standards required for their projects.

  5. Signal-to-Noise Ratio (SNR)
    Definition: A measure that compares the level of a desired signal to the level of background noise.
    Importance: A higher SNR indicates clearer sound quality, which is particularly important in professional audio settings. B2B buyers should prioritize equipment with high SNR ratings to ensure high-fidelity audio production.

Common Trade Terminology in Music Equipment

Familiarity with industry jargon is essential for effective communication and negotiation in the music equipment sector. Here are some common terms:

  1. OEM (Original Equipment Manufacturer)
    Definition: A company that produces parts or equipment that may be marketed by another manufacturer.
    Significance: Understanding OEM relationships helps buyers identify reliable sources for components and negotiate better pricing.

  2. MOQ (Minimum Order Quantity)
    Definition: The smallest quantity of a product that a supplier is willing to sell.
    Significance: Knowing the MOQ is vital for budget planning and inventory management. It can also affect pricing, as purchasing at or above the MOQ may yield discounts.

  3. RFQ (Request for Quotation)
    Definition: A document sent to suppliers to solicit price quotes for specific products or services.
    Significance: Utilizing RFQs allows buyers to compare offers from different suppliers, ensuring they obtain the best price and terms for their purchases.

  4. Incoterms (International Commercial Terms)
    Definition: A series of pre-defined commercial terms published by the International Chamber of Commerce (ICC) relating to international commercial law.
    Significance: Familiarity with Incoterms is critical for B2B transactions, as they define the responsibilities of buyers and sellers regarding shipping, risk, and insurance.

  5. Lead Time
    Definition: The amount of time it takes from placing an order until it is fulfilled.
    Significance: Understanding lead times helps buyers plan their inventory and project timelines effectively, ensuring they have the necessary equipment when needed.

  3. What are the typical lead times and minimum order quantities (MOQ) for music equipment?
    Lead times can vary based on the type of equipment, complexity of the order, and the supplier’s location. Generally, expect lead times of 4-12 weeks for standard products, while custom orders may take longer. MOQs also vary; some suppliers may require a minimum of 100 units, while others might accept smaller orders. Always confirm these details upfront to avoid unexpected delays and ensure that your order aligns with your business needs.

  4. How do I ensure quality assurance and certification compliance?
    To ensure quality assurance, request documentation of the supplier’s quality control processes and any relevant certifications such as ISO 9001. Ask for product samples to evaluate quality firsthand. Additionally, inquire about their compliance with international standards, particularly if you plan to sell in specific markets. Establish clear quality expectations in your contract, and consider third-party inspections for added assurance before shipment.

  5. What payment terms should I expect when sourcing music equipment?
    Payment terms can vary widely among suppliers, often influenced by the order size and relationship history. Common terms include a deposit upfront (usually 30-50%) with the balance due upon delivery or before shipment. Negotiate terms that align with your cash flow needs and consider using escrow services for larger transactions to protect both parties. Always document payment terms in your purchase agreement to prevent disputes.
